Student Education Program
1. A total of 354 students between grades 4-8 responded to the survey
2. Based on the pre survey, on average 56.59% of students knew traffic safety rules
3. After the implementation of traffic education program, there was
33.1% improvement in the knowledge of traffic safety involving walking scenarios
6.08% improvement in the knowledge of traffic safety involving driving drop off scenarios
18.66% overall improvement in the knowledge of traffic safety

Parent Awareness Program
Biggest improvement was in the driving behavior of parents in the drop off lane such as cars properly pulled forward, no attended vehicles etc
While there was some improvement in the parent behavior in jay walking and walking through bushes during the week, it reversed on the last day of the campaign.
Overall, more work is needed to change parents' behavior in following traffic safety rules around schools.
